• ベストアンサー

エクセルマクロ解除の質問です。

以前に作成されたエクセルファイル(前の担当者が作成したもの)で、この開く際に  「マクロが含まれています…」 との確認メッセージが出てきます。メニューバーからマクロを見てもマクロののオブジェクトはありません。推測ですが、一度、マクロを使用していて、そのオブジェクトを削除したのだと思います。 動作上は、ファイルを開く際のワンクリックの手間だけなのですが、この確認メッセージが出ないようにするにはどうしたら良いのでしょうか。

質問者が選んだベストアンサー

  • ベストアンサー
  • merlionXX
  • ベストアンサー率48% (1930/4007)
回答No.1

メニューバーから覗いただけですべてのマクロの記述が見えるわけではありません。 Altキー+F11キーでVisual Vasic Editorを立ち上げ、標準モジュールがあればモジュールごと削除、ワークシートごとのシートモジュールも全シート確認し、記述があれば消去してみてください。 ThisWorkbookの中もわすれずに。

kamejiro
質問者

お礼

早急の回答、ありがとうございます。 対処できました。ここ数年、先延ばしをしていましたが、スッキリしました。

全文を見る
すると、全ての回答が全文表示されます。

その他の回答 (3)

  • web2525
  • ベストアンサー率42% (1219/2850)
回答No.4

VBエディターを開いてモジュールを開放してやれば表示されなくなると思います。

kamejiro
質問者

お礼

VBエディターまでは確認できていませんでした。

全文を見る
すると、全ての回答が全文表示されます。
  • marbin
  • ベストアンサー率27% (636/2290)
回答No.3

参考になると思います。 エクセル奇譚-マクロあります http://hp.vector.co.jp/authors/VA016119/kitan01.html

kamejiro
質問者

お礼

こんな、ページがあったのですね。大変参考になりました。 ありがとうございます。感謝!。感謝!。

全文を見る
すると、全ての回答が全文表示されます。
noname#123709
noname#123709
回答No.2

本当にマクロは含まれていないのでしょうか? VBEで確認されました? シートモジュールや書き方によってはVBEからしか見えない ものもあります。 前任者がすべて削除したのであれば「マクロが・・・」はでないと 思います。

kamejiro
質問者

お礼

VBEでの確認までは知りませんでした。

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• TeraTermのマクロについて

    Termのメニューバーの操作を起因としたマクロは組めないのでしょうか? 例としましては、メニューバーから張り付けを実行した際にメッセージボックスに張り付ける内容が表示されYES、NOで張り付けたり中止したりといった操作が出来るマクロです。 それと、もうひとつ。 エクセルの「新しいマクロの記録」のような機能はTermに存在しますか? 存在する場合、どのように確認すればよいでしょうか? マクロ自体はエクセルマクロの基礎を押さえてる程度です。 解答出来る方、いらっしゃいましたらお願いします。

  • エクセル2007でマクロを有効にするには?

    ご存じの方教えて下さい。 エクセルの2007を使用しています。  エクセル2003のマクロファイルなんですが、ファイルを開いた際、2003だとマクロを有効にしますか?と聞いてきましたが、2007では何も聞いてきません。  2003で作成したマクロファイルは、2007では使用できないのでしょうか?

  • Excel97で作成したマクロをExcel2000で使えず・・・

    よ~く探せば同内容の質問が過去にあるかもしれないのですが、多すぎて探せなかったので、質問します。すいませんが宜しくお願いします。 会社のPC(OSはWin95)のエクセル97でマクロを作成して、共有データエリアに保存し、別のPC(OSはWin98)のエクセル2000で実行しようとしたら、***はマクロを含んでいますとメッセージが出て、マクロを有効にすると、オブジェクトライブラリは登録されていませんというメッセージが出てきたので、OKにし、もう一度マクロを有効にしたら、「***の修復   ***にエラーが検出されましたがMicrosoftExcelは次の修復を行うことによってファイルを開くことができました。修復を保持するにはこのファイルを保存してください。  VisualBasicプロジェクトが失われました。 ActiveXコントロールが失われました。」というエラーメッセージが出てきて、マクロがなくなってしまい、また新しくマクロを記録しようとしても、記録できません、というエラーメッセージが出てきてマクロが作れなくなってしまいました。 尚、セキュリティは中にしてありますが、低でもマクロの記録ができないです。なぜでしょう?

  • エクセルでマクロを含むファイルだけメニューバーに登録(表示)したい

    エクセルでマクロをメニューバーに登録した場合、マクロを含まないファイルを立ち上げても、メニューバーに表示されてしまいますが、これを表示しないようにするにはどうすればよいのでしょうか?

  • エクセルのマクロで、シートを削除するとき・・・

    エクセルのマクロでシートを削除するとき、 「データが存在する可能性があります。削除しますか?」と確認メッセージが出てきます。そこで、「削除する」というボタンを押さないといけません。 この確認をいちいち出さないで(つまりマクロではその確認は不要。削除するボタンを押す手間を省きたい)、マクロでシート削除をしたいのです。 確認メッセージを出さないでマクロでシート削除する方法を教えてください。お願いします。

  • Excelマクロの削除

    Excelにて別のExcelのデータをコピーし、名前を付けて保存するマクロを作成しております。 その際、新しく作成したファイルにマクロが残ってしまいます。そのファイルにマクロを残さない方法はありますか? またそのマクロをツール→マクロ→削除をしても次回、ファイルを開いたときに、マクロの有効無効を聞かれます。 他にマクロを削除する場所があるのでしょうか? よろしくお願いします。

  • エクセルファイルを開くときに「マクロを含んでいる」とポップアップがでますが

    エクセルで表を作っていますが なぜかファイルを開く時に 「○○.xlsファイルはマクロを含んでいます。」とポップアップが でて、マクロを有効にするか、無効にするかを指示しなくては なりません。メニューバーの「ツール」の中の「マクロ」を 開いてみてもマクロが存在していないのに どうしてでしょうか?

  • エクセル マクロ 表示ボックス?

    エクセル2002を使用しています。 「コントールツールボックス」の「スクロールバー」を動かしている際に 表示ボックス?で現在の数値を表示させることができるコマンドがあるのでしょうか? よくファイルやメニューにマウスをのせると表示される添付のような表示ボックスです。 リスクしているセルは、別シートに配置しているため、数値を把握するには、 シートを変える必要があるので、できれば表示メッセージ系のマクロなどあったら助かります。 ご教授して頂けると助かります。

  • マクロの完全消去法

     かれこれ3~4年ものの悩みです。 エクセルでワークシートを作成中、戯れにマクロを作成、飽きたので削除してから保存したのですが、以後そのファイルを起動する度に「このファイルにはマクロが含まれています(マクロを有効にする/無効にする)」というダイアログが出てきます。  人に扱わせる時にうっとうしいので、出ないようにしたいのですが、完全に削除仕切れていないとすれば、どこをいじれば良いのでしょう? ※ツールバーの「マクロ」メニューで確認しても、マクロは確認できません。

  • Excelのマクロについて

    普通マクロで作成したエクセルファイルを起動すると、マクロの「有効」「無効」を選択する画面が出てきます。 会社内のネットワークで文書を共有しており、エクセル2003がはいっているパソコンは、エクセルファイルを起動すると、選択する画面が出てきますが、エクセル2000がはいっているパソコンでは、マクロで作成したエクセルファイル(同じもの)を開いても選択画面が出なく、すぐにエクセルのシートが出てきます。 エクセル2000がはいっているパソコンで、マクロで作成したファイルとして選択画面が表示されるようにするためにはどのようにしたらよろしいのでしょうか? 恐れ入りますが、よろしくお願いいたします。

専門家に質問してみよう